Berberine Explained: What It Is and Its Origins
Berberine represents a bioactive substance discovered in multiple plant species, such as goldenseal, barberry, and Chinese goldthread. This natural compound has been employed in traditional medicine for centuries, particularly in Asian cultures, where it is appreciated for its numerous health-promoting properties. Berberine exhibits a distinctive yellow color, which is a hallmark of its natural sources. The compound is chiefly extracted from the roots, stems, and bark of these plants, rendering it available for herbal supplements. Recent interest in berberine has surged due to its potential benefits, prompting extensive research into its effects on metabolic health. Its unique chemical structure allows it to interact with multiple biological pathways, rendering it a substance of considerable importance in both traditional and modern medical practices.

Controls Metabolic Activities
A key element of berberine's role in weight loss is its ability to regulate metabolic functions. This compound affects various biochemical pathways that are essential for maintaining energy homeostasis. Berberine activates AMPK (AMP-activated protein kinase), which plays a pivotal role in energy metabolism by enhancing the body's capability to burn fat and glucose. By enhancing mitochondrial function, berberine promotes greater energy expenditure, which can aid in weight loss. Moreover, it regulates lipid metabolism, helping to reduce fat accumulation and support lean muscle mass preservation. These metabolic improvements can create a more efficient energy balance, making it more feasible for individuals to achieve and maintain their weight loss goals. Altogether, berberine's influence on metabolism demonstrates its potential as a weight loss aid.

The Science Behind Berberine's Metabolic Benefits
Numerous studies suggest that berberine has a major impact on boosting metabolism, which can support weight loss. This compound is known to activate an enzyme called AMP-activated protein kinase (AMPK), which is essential for regulating energy metabolism. By boosting AMPK activity, berberine encourages elevated fat oxidation and glucose uptake in cells. Furthermore, it modulates mitochondrial function, producing better energy expenditure. As a result, the body becomes more efficient at burning calories, even at rest. Berberine's capability to modulate metabolic pathways not only supports weight management but also maintains overall metabolic health. Therefore, incorporating berberine into a weight loss regimen might deliver a natural approach to optimizing metabolic efficiency.

Recommended Dosage Suggestions
Establishing the right dosage of berberine is essential for enhancing its weight loss advantages. Evidence shows a typical dosage range of 900 to 2,000 mg per day, often split into two to three doses for maximum absorption. Commencing with a lower dose, around 500 mg, can help assess individual tolerance before gradually increasing it. It is essential to consult a healthcare professional for personalized recommendations, particularly for those with underlying health conditions or who are taking medications. Consistency in dosage is crucial, as regular intake can boost the compound's effects on metabolic health and fat loss. Adhering to these guidelines can help individuals in achieving their weight loss goals efficiently while minimizing potential side effects.

What Are the Side Effects of Berberine?
What adverse effects should people keep in mind when consuming berberine? Despite berberine being widely viewed as safe, some people could face intestinal difficulties, like constipation, diarrhea, or abdominal cramping. These reactions frequently stem from its effect on digestive function and gut microbiome. Moreover, berberine might lower sugar levels in the blood, which could result in hypoglycemia, particularly for people using diabetic drugs. Hepatic function represents another consideration; excessive use could potentially affect liver enzyme levels. Though uncommon, allergic responses can occur. Consulting healthcare experts is vital for individuals prior to beginning berberine supplementation, particularly if they are pregnant, nursing, or have pre-existing health conditions. Monitoring for side effects can help guarantee effective and secure utilization.
